#TheNewWorldOrder : The RT angle behind the Saudi-Iran peace deal | World News Breaking News #TheNewWorldOrder : The RT angle behind the Saudi-Iran peace deal | World News Keith Bowman April 11, 2023 25 In March 2023, Saudi Arabia and Iran signed an agreement to open diplomatic channels, ending a long-standing...Read More